Subject: Tax-rate lookup cache — new point person

Hi support crew, small org update. The tax-rate lookup cache in Ledgerly — the thing that keeps checkout from hammering the Ratefinder service — is moving to a new owner. That means stale-rate escalations, cache-flush requests, and those fun "why is the Westmoor county rate wrong" tickets all get a new destination. The old alias will forward for two weeks, then it's gone, so update your macros now. Effective this Friday, all cache-related escalations should be routed to the person named here.

named custodian: Belius Casath Ulaix Sorius

**Action item (TIDE-14):** The Moonbrook tide-table widget cached predictions keyed by station name rather than station identifier, so plugins targeting renamed stations silently rendered stale data for up to six days. We are migrating the cache key to the stable identifier and deprecating name-based lookups in the next plugin API release. Plugin authors should review the migration guide and deprecation timeline, which we have published on the developer portal page.

runbook for tajep-yahig: https://artifactory.lumictech.corp/repo

**Minutes – Management Meeting, Thursday**

Attendees: heads of department, chaired by Petra Vols.

Main item: lease renegotiation for the Harwick Lane office. Our landlord, Bremmer Estates, has signalled openness to a five-year term with a rent-free first quarter. Dario will push for break clauses at years two and four. Facilities to cost up refurbishment before we commit. Decision deferred to next month's session. Please keep the following strictly within this group.

internal memo for kaduf-baduf: Only 35 of the 378 pilot accounts renewed Holir, so a churn review is set for June 11. Eliielax Group is in early talks to buy Silaelix Group for about $142.1 million.